Though thermal paper evolved from the invention of sensitized paper invented over 50 years ago, Ricoh entered the thermal paper business in 1977 by manufacturing recording paper for measuring instruments and thermo-sensitive paper for fax machines. After only three years, production increased to meet an increasing market demand.

By 1980, with R&D efforts intensified, Ricoh was able to develop the world's first thermal paper for point-of-sale (POS) label. By 1981, the production volume and sales increased dramatically. A true pacesetter, Ricoh installed the world's largest coater at its Fukui, Japan plant in 1985. The same year, Ricoh Electronics started manufacturing thermal paper with the installation of a state-of-the-art coater in the U.S.

Ricoh Electronics began marketing thermal sensitive papers through its own sales network in 1982. Since 1985, these products have been manufactured at the company's 112,000 square-foot Santa Ana facility. Local production as well as R&D capabilities have been expanded to meet the growing service and new product development needs of Ricoh customers.

Thermal Media Applications


Today's thermal papers made by Ricoh have a wide variety of uses and applications:

Government: Shipping ID labels, Postal labels, Asset Identification Automotive: AIAG labels, Parts ID labels, Bills of lading, Shipping labels, Packing lists, Window stickers, Assembly tags Health Care: HIBC Bar codes, Consumable bar code labels, Specimen labels, Pharmacy labels, Lab reports, In-patient and Out-patient records, Wristband labels Retail: UPC marketing, Shelf labels and tags, Warehouse case labels, Supermarket food labels Warehousing/Distribution: UPC shipping container symbol, Receiving, Order picking General Manufacturing: Work in process control, Shipment verification, Inventory packing, Receiving, Asset Management Cargo/Freight Handling: Air freight bills, Manifests, Baggage tags, Pro # labels, Load verification.

Ricoh also offers a unique line of strong, resin-based thermal transfer ribbons which provide users with a smear- and heat-resistant product.
